Even Today, treehouses are constructed by some native people so as to escape the danger and adversity on the floor in some areas of the tropics. It's been maintained that most the Korowai clans, a Papuan tribe at the southeast of Irian Jaya, reside in tree houses on their isolated territory as protection against a tribe of neighbouring head-hunters, the Citak.The BBC revealed in 2018 the Korowai had assembled tree houses"for the benefit of international programme makers" and did not really reside in them.

In modern societiesModern Tree houses are usually built as a hut for children or for leisure purposes. Contemporary tree houses might also be integrated into existing hotel amenities.

Together with underground and floor level houses, tree houses are An alternative for building eco-friendly houses in remote forest areas, since they don't expect a clearing of some certain area of forest. On the other hand, the wildlife, climate and illumination on ground level in areas of compact close-canopy woods isn't desirable to some people.There are many techniques to fasten the construction to the tree that want to minimize tree damage. Struts and stilts are used for relieving weights onto a lower altitude or right to the ground; Tree homes supported by stilts weigh much less on the tree and help to avoid stress, potential strain, and harm caused by puncture holes. Stilts are typically anchored to the floor with concrete but fresh designs, like the"Diamond Pier", accelerates installation time and they are less invasive for the origin system. Stilts are regarded as the easiest way of encouraging larger tree homes, and may also raise structural support and safety.Stay rods are used for relieving weights onto a higher altitude. All these Systems are especially useful to control motions caused by wind or tree development, however they're the used less often, due to the natural limits of these systems. Greater elevation and more branches tailing off reduces increases and capacity end sensibility. As building materials for hanging are utilized ropes, wire cables, tension fasteners, springs etc..

Friction and stress attachments are the most common noninvasive procedures of securing tree houses. They do not utilize claws , screws or bolts, but rather grip the beams into the trunk by way of counter-beam, threaded bars, or tying.Invasive methods are all methods that use screws, nails, bolts, Because these methods require punctures from the shrub, they need to be planned correctly so as to reduce stress. Not all species of plants suffer with multiplying in the exact same way, depending partly on whether the sap conduits operate in the pith or from the bark. Nails are usually not recommended. A special sort of bolt developed in the 1990s called a treehouse attachment spool (TAB) can support greater weights compared to earlier methods.

Since the mid-1990s, recreational tree houses have enjoyed a growth in popularity in countries such as the United States and portions of Europe. This was due to greater disposable income, better technology for builders, study into safe building practices and a heightened fascination with environmental problems , particularly sustainable dwelling . This growing popularity can be reflected in an increase of social media channels, sites, and television shows especially devoted to including remarkable tree houses around the globe. {There are over 30 businesses in Europe and the USA specializing in the construction of tree houses of different degrees of permanence and sophistication, from children's play structures to fully functioning homes.

Many Regions of the world Don't Have Any specific planning laws for tree Homes, so the legal issues could be confusing to both the builder and the local planning departments only. Treehouses can be cheated, partially regulated or fully regulated - depending on the locale.In some cases, tree homes are exempted from regular building Regulations, as they are considered outside the regulations specification. An exemption may be given to a builder in case the tree home is in a remote or non-urban location. Alternately, a tree house could possibly be included in the exact same class as structures such as garden sheds, sometimes known as a"temporary structure". There could be restrictions on elevation, distance from boundary and privacy for nearby properties. There are various grey regions in these laws, since they weren't specifically made for tree-borne structures. A very small number of planning sections have regulations for tree homes, which set out clearly what may be constructed and where. Tree Wood Density and Fastener QualityLarge tree homes that consider over the collective weight of the occupants should be made carefully, As various facets like the hardness of the shrub along with fastener quality and design come more to play. Wood will compress in which the attachments connect to the tree into varying amounts based on the hardness of this tree in question, resulting in a sinking of the tree house.

Professional-grade Tree home Fasteners - Are they Necessary?There are many different tree home fasteners on the market today manufactured specially for their distinctive needs. But the question always arises concerning how necessary these customized bolts and brackets Are in comparison to ordinary ones found in home centers because of their cost. They frequently cost between one and several hundred dollars per year!These rather expensive parts of hardware is the trees are living organisms, and are still climbing, moving, and changing shape. Thus, your tree house as well as the hardware on which it is mounted must accommodate this movement. Simply bolting the beams into the tree's branches results in a fixed attachment which will force the tree to pull the screw through the beam or attempt to grow around the beam.The very first of the two will result in a sudden and dangerous failure, While the next will result in an unhealthy and unnatural growth around the beam, possibly causing disease and decay to set in. Customized bolts and brackets are made with a particular allowance for tree development, with a section of the bolt that's embedded deep inside the tree's heartwood and a large shank that allows rotational movement combined with a female component that's connected to the beam.

So to answer the question of whether these expensive custom parts are necessary, the brief answer is yes, and no. Yes, if you lack the know-how to discover parts that will accomplish the exact same function as the skilled components do, then no, in case you do, then do not require your tree house to last for fifty years. Home centers sell hardware and bolts with big diameters and lengths that could be used, but the entire shank cannot be threaded.The half or so that Is embedded into the tree must be threaded, however, the rest that acts as the cushion to compensate for tree-growth must be smooth. You also require a female piece that fits round the smooth shank that has a bracket which can be screwed into your beam. This female bracket then gets the liberty to slip across the axis of the bolt shank as the tree grows in diameter. All parts should be stainless steel too - others may corrode to failure.
